Try lowering the water's temperaute, and turning the fan on in your … I share you a smart tool called Video to Blu-ray Burner, it is easy to use and powerful … WebApr 5, 2024 · Emergency showers are designed to flush the user's head and body. They should not be used to flush the user's eyes because the high rate or pressure of water flow could damage the eyes in some instances. Eyewash stations are designed to flush the eye and face area only.
